Clinically, combining epidural with general anaesthesia may confer many advantages to patients undergoing major thoracic, abdominal or orthopaedic surgery. Epidural anaesthesia can attenuate sympathetic hyperactivity and the stress response, maintain bowel peristalsis, spare the use of opioids, and facilitate postoperative feeding and physiotherapy. However, establishing epidural anesthesia is not without risks and contraindications, including refusal by the patient, technical failure, unintentional dural puncture, waist and back pain and local anaesthetic toxicity. When neurologic complications do occur, the resulting morbidity and mortality is considerable. Dexmedetomidine is a potent α2-adrenoceptor agonist with an 8 times greater affinity for α2-adrenoceptors than clonidine. This class of agent is known to have sedative, anxiolytic, anti-shivering, analgesic, and anaesthetic sparing effect. In addition α2-adrenoceptor agonists reduce central sympathetic outflow and attenuate the stress response associated with surgery.1 Unlike epidural anaesthesia, dexmedetomidine is easy to administer and no potential for neurological damage. The investigators hypothesize that the dexmedetomidine reduces the stress response of surgery to the similar extent to epidural anaesthesia when used in conjunction with a standard general anaesthesia for abdominal surgery.

| Label | Type | Description | Intervention Names |
|---|---|---|---|
| dexmedetomidine | Experimental | Drug:dexmedetomidine,dexmedetomidine 1.0μg/kg intravenous injection within 15 minutes before the induction of general anesthesia and followed by Dex 0.4μg/kg/h until 40min before the end of surgery |
|
| epidural | Active Comparator | Epidural:continuous epidural block (T8-9) 4 mL of 1.6% lidocaine as a test dose and continous infusion of 0.375% ropivacaine(5 mL/h) during the surgery |
|
| control | Placebo Comparator | Drug: normalsaline |
